Clarity and Protection for Both Parties

Employment contracts serve as a cornerstone in establishing clear expectations and safeguarding the interests of both employers and employees. These legally binding documents outline crucial aspects of the working relationship, including job responsibilities, compensation, and benefits. By providing a detailed framework, employment contracts minimize misunderstandings and potential disputes, fostering a more harmonious work environment. Moreover, they offer protection to both parties by clearly defining terms such as confidentiality agreements, non-compete clauses, and intellectual property rights. This clarity not only promotes trust but also helps prevent costly litigation down the road. Flexibility and Customization

One of the most significant advantages of employment contracts is their inherent flexibility. These agreements can be tailored to suit the unique needs of your business and the specific role of each employee. Whether you’re hiring for a high-level executive position or a specialized technical role, employment contracts can be crafted to address particular concerns and objectives. This customization allows for the inclusion of performance-based incentives, stock options, or specific work arrangements like remote or flexible schedules. By leveraging this flexibility, employers can create more attractive compensation packages and working conditions, giving them a competitive edge in talent acquisition and retention. When You Might Need an Attorney for Employment Contracts

Employment contracts play a crucial role in establishing clear expectations and protecting both employers and employees in various work scenarios. You might need an employment contract when starting a new job, especially in higher-level positions or roles involving sensitive information. These agreements are also essential when transitioning from part-time to full-time employment, or when accepting a promotion that comes with increased responsibilities. Additionally, employment contracts become necessary when negotiating unique work arrangements, such as remote work or flexible schedules, to ensure both parties understand and agree to the terms.

Whether you’re an employer looking to safeguard your company’s interests or an employee seeking to secure your rights and benefits, having a well-crafted employment contract is invaluable. These documents can address crucial aspects such as compensation, job duties, confidentiality clauses, and termination conditions.
